What Is Cloud Automation?


Cloud automation refers to the use of software-driven workflows to manage cloud infrastructure and operations with minimal manual intervention. This includes provisioning, configuration, monitoring, scaling, and lifecycle management.


Automation does not remove human oversight. Instead, it reduces repetitive tasks, limits configuration drift, and enforces predefined standards across environments.


Key Cloud Automation Benefits for Enterprises


  1. 1. Operational Efficiency


    One of the most immediate benefits of cloud automation is improved efficiency. Automated workflows allow IT teams to:

    • Provision resources faster
    • Apply consistent configurations
    • Reduce time spent on repetitive tasks

    This frees engineers to focus on higher-value work such as architecture, optimization, and security planning.


  2. 2. Cost Reduction Through Control


    Automation plays a direct role in cost reduction by minimizing waste and inefficiency. Enterprises can:

    • Decommission unused resources automatically
    • Enforce standardized resource sizing
    • Reduce errors that lead to rework or downtime

    Rather than relying on ad-hoc controls, automation embeds cost discipline into daily operations.


  3. 3. Consistency and Reduced Risk


    Manual processes introduce variability. Automation enforces consistency by applying the same rules every time.


    This results in:

    • Fewer configuration errors
    • Reduced operational risk
    • More predictable system behavior

    For regulated and business-critical environments, this consistency is essential.


  4. 4. Faster Incident Response


    Automation can support monitoring and remediation workflows that react faster than manual intervention. While not replacing human decision-making, automation helps:

    • Detect issues earlier
    • Trigger predefined responses
    • Shorten recovery times

    This improves overall service reliability.


Automation in Enterprise Cloud Operations


Cloud automation is most effective when applied selectively. Common enterprise use cases include:

  • Infrastructure provisioning and lifecycle management
  • Configuration and compliance enforcement
  • Backup and recovery workflows
  • Monitoring and alerting processes

The goal is not full autonomy, but controlled, repeatable operations.
